Video shows thieves stealing $5 million in jewelry from Atlanta store

ATLANTA, Nov. 15 (UPI) -- Three people who stole more than $5 million in jewelry from an Atlanta store in November are still at large, police said as a surveillance video was released.

The video, from the Elif Fine Jewelry store in Atlanta's Buckhead section, shows the suspects using hammers to break glass cases and steal rings, bracelets and watches, WSB-TV, Atlanta, reported Friday.

"Very bold. You get the impression that these suspects knew what they were doing," said Atlanta police Sgt. Greg Lyon.

The police report added one suspect threatened to shoot employees if they did not lay face down in a break room in the back of the store during the heist.

An employee of a nearby store said the suspects drove away in an SUV with Florida license plates.

Police admit they are having a hard time solving the Nov. 7 robbery.

"The men are masked so it's difficult to make out their faces. We're still hoping that by releasing the video, someone out there will be able to help us out," Lyon said.
